Does link building still matter for AI search?
- Yes, in two ways. Google AI Overviews mostly cite pages that already rank, and links remain a ranking signal. Answer engines such as ChatGPT and Perplexity weigh brand mentions on trusted third-party sources when deciding who to recommend. Links and mentions on the right sources move both.
What kind of links do you build?
- Editorial placements on real publications, expert quotes, resource mentions, inclusion in comparison and best-of pages, and digital PR around original data. We do not use link networks, paid link farms or automated outreach.
How do you choose target sites?
- By checking which sources the engines actually cite for your topic. A site the engines never draw on adds little, however high its metrics. A community thread they cite every week can be worth more than a big-name placement.
How many links per month?
- It depends on the topic and the sources available, and we would rather report five placements that moved your citations than fifty that did nothing. Volume is agreed after the source map, not before.
